Joao Nuno Ferreira is the Technical Director at the Foundation for National Scientific Computing (FCCN). Previously, he was the Head of the Technical Staff at FCCN.[1]

As the Technical Director at FCCN, Joao Nuno Ferreira has stressed the importance of migrating from IPv4 to IPv6, due to an overflow of IPv4 adresses.[2]

Joao Nuno Ferreira is the coordinator of the Administration and Practice Group of the IPv6 Task force. [3]

Joao Nuno Ferreira is also very involved with the Feasibility Study for African – European Research and Education Network Interconnection (FEAST) Project which deals with NREN Twinning between African and European NRENs.[4] [5]

Joao Nuno Ferreira has contributed to a lot of books or presentations. He has contributed to the Site Security Handbook,[6] IPv6 Tutorial,[7] Deliverable D3.4.2 of 6net.org[8] and the material at Southern Africa 6DISS.[9]
